Hoodlums said to Okada riders on Wednesday attacked traders at Dei Dei, a community in Abuja Municipal Area Council (AMAC) of the Federal Capital Territory (FCT).
The incident led to the death of at least five persons, while houses and other properties were set ablaze.
Reports said an accident involving a bike man led to the break down of law and order in the community.
A twitter user said the incident involved Okada riders who are mostly northerners and traders of mostly Igbo origin.
THE WITNESS cannot immediately verify this claim.
